图像处理装置及其控制方法

文档序号:8266329阅读:162来源:国知局
图像处理装置及其控制方法
【技术领域】
[0001]本发明涉及图像处理装置、该图像处理装置的控制方法以及针对该控制方法的程序。
【背景技术】
[0002]当利用具有平板扫描器的传统多功能机扫描多个原稿时,需要逐一读取原稿,然后开始扫描所读取的原稿。即,需要进行如下的复杂过程:将原稿逐一放置在平板稿台玻璃上、在放置原稿前后打开和关闭稿台玻璃的盖、并且按下用于扫描的读取开始按钮。
[0003]当利用具有ADF(自动原稿给送器)的多功能机扫描多个原稿时,仅必须将原稿一次性地放置到ADF,然后按下读取开始按钮。因此,能够跳过上述复杂过程。
[0004]然而,利用具有ADF的多功能机的这种操作无法处理对多个原稿的各个进行不同处理的情况。例如,上述操作无法处理彩色扫描包括字符和图像的原稿A并且黑白扫描仅包括字符的下一原稿B的情况。此外,当利用平板多功能机对多个原稿进行上述处理时,需要对各原稿进行上述复杂过程并且还需要在扫描各原稿前进行设置。
[0005]另外,当用户确认扫描图像的内容时,用户存在在进行扫描后打开预览画面、然后选择用于预览的扫描数据的麻烦。
[0006]为了减少当进行扫描时的这类必要的麻烦,存在如下技术,在对放置在原稿台上的原稿进行拍摄的照相机扫描器中,检测出原稿搁置在原稿台上,然后对搁置的原稿进行拍摄(例如,日本专利特开第2007-208821号公报)。
[0007]根据上述技术,由于能够仅通过将原稿摆放在原稿台上来进行扫描,因此能够大大减少在包括原稿台的盖的打开/关闭、按钮的按下等的扫描中的麻烦。
[0008]另外,为了减少对原稿的内容确认的麻烦,存在在原稿台上显示由照相机读取的原稿的技术(例如,日本专利特愿第2005-252737号公报,或者日本专利特开第2012-053545 号公报)。
[0009]在日本专利特愿第2005-252737号公报公开的技术中,照相机扫描器的原稿台用作显示器,并且拍摄的原稿的图像在显示器上被显示预定时间以使得用户能够容易确认所拍摄的原稿的内容,由此改善可操作性。
[0010]在日本专利特开第2012-053545号公报公开的技术中,通过投影仪投影的电子介质与纸质原稿交叠并被拍摄以生成该电子介质与该纸质原稿的数据已被组合的数据,并且所生成的数据被投影在与电子介质被投影到的位置相同的位置。
[0011]这里,假设在如日本专利特开第2007-208821号公报中的通过利用搁置检测的照相机扫描来连续读取原稿的系统中,在确认原稿的各内容的同时,针对确认了的原稿,在每次扫描时,进行诸如彩色设置等的不同处理。
[0012]在这种情况下,如果如日本专利特愿第2005-252737号公报中公开的技术仅进行预定时间的显示,则存在所显示的原稿在针对该原稿的操作完成前消失的可能性。
[0013]另外,在如日本专利特愿第2005-252737号公报中公开的技术在显示器上显示扫描数据的同时或者如日本专利特开第2012-053545号公报中公开的技术通过投影仪投影扫描数据的同时期望读取下一原稿的情况下,期望读取的原稿与被显示或投影的图像彼此交叠。这样,原稿的识别率劣化。
[0014]另一方面,存在通过在由照相机的手动拍摄的定时、隐藏(即,成为非显示状态)投影图像而不读取与期望读取的图像以外的图像对应的投影图像的技术(例如,日本专利特开第2006-184333号公报)。然而,在日本专利特开第2006-184333号公报公开的技术中,由于在由照相机的手动拍摄的定时不显示投影图像,所以在连续拍摄原稿时必须逐页进行操作。

【发明内容】

[0015]因此,本发明的目的在于提供如下的图像处理装置、该图像处理装置的控制方法以及要用于进行该控制方法的程序,该图像处理装置改善了使用拍摄原稿并显示拍摄的原稿的图像处理装置的用户的可操作性。
[0016]为了实现以上目的,在本发明中,提供一种图像处理装置,其配备有对能够摆放原稿的摄像区域进行拍摄的摄像设备以及能够显示图像的显示设备,该图像处理装置包括:提取单元,其被构造为从通过利用所述摄像设备对摆放有所述原稿的所述摄像区域进行拍摄而获得的图像中,提取表示所述原稿的图像的原稿图像数据;残留图像显示单元,其被构造为使所述显示设备在所述原稿被摆放的位置,显示由通过所述提取单元提取的所述原稿图像数据生成的并且对应于所述原稿的图像的残留图像;检测单元,其被构造为检测所述原稿进入用于检测所述原稿的检测区域;以及缩略图像显示单元,其被构造为响应于通过所述检测单元检测到所述原稿进入所述检测区域,使所述显示设备以使得所述残留图像的缩略图像不与进入所述检测区域的所述原稿交叠的方式显示所述缩略图像。
[0017]根据本发明,与表示原稿的图像对应的残留图像被显示在所述原稿被摆放的位置,并且如果检测到所述原稿进入到检测区域,则以使得所述残留图像的缩略图像不与进入所述检测区域的所述原稿交叠的方式显示所述缩略图像。这样,由于用作用于确认的残留图像的缩略图像每次被自动显示,因此能够提高使用对原稿进行拍摄并显示表示所拍摄的原稿的图像的图像处理装置的用户的可操作性。
[0018]根据以下参照附图对示例性实施例的描述,本发明的其他特征将变得清楚。
【附图说明】
[0019]图1是例示根据本发明的实施例的包括照相机扫描器的扫描器系统的示意图。
[0020]图2是例示图1的照相机扫描器的外观的图。
[0021]图3是例示图2的控制器单元的示意框图。
[0022]图4是例示用于控制图1的照相机扫描器的程序的框图。
[0023]图5A、图5B和图5C是例示图3的HDD(硬盘驱动器)中的、通过对图2中的读取区域进行拍摄获得的读取区域背景图像被存储到的记录区域的构造的图。
[0024]图6A、图6B和图6C是例示图3的HDD中的、原稿图像数据被存储到的记录区域的构造的图。
[0025]图7A、图7B和图7C是例示要被存储在图3的RAM (随机存取存储器)中的文档属性信息以及图像属性信息的图。
[0026]图8A、图8B、图8C、图8D、图8E以及图8F是用于描述原稿操作以及显示图像的示例的图。
[0027]图9是例示通过利用照相机进行拍摄获得的图像以及投影变换后的图像的图。
[0028]图10是表示要通过图4的摄像处理部进行的初始化设置处理的过程的流程图。
[0029]图11是表示主要通过图4的摄像处理部以及定时检测部进行的残留图像投影处理的过程的流程图。
[0030]图12A、图12B、图12C、图12D、图12E、图12F、图12G和图12H是用于描述检测入镜(frame-1n)或出镜(frame-out)的方法的图。
[0031]图13是表示图11的S621中的原稿图像数据提取处理的过程的流程图。
[0032]图14是表示图11的S620中的输出文件生成处理的过程的流程图。
[0033]图15是表示图11的S623中的残留图像处理的过程的流程图。
[0034]图16A、图16B、图16C、图16D、图16E和图16F是用于描述原稿操作以及显示图像的示例的图。
[0035]图17是表示主要由图4的摄像处理部和定时检测部进行的残留图像投影处理的过程的流程图。
[0036]图18A是例示了原稿图像数据的坐标的图,图18B是例示了显示图像的示例的图,以及图18C是例示了从读取区域205中的残留图像区域2101提取的残留图像2102的图。
[0037]图19是表示图17的S625中的移动识别处理的过程的流程图。
[0038]图20A和图20B是用于描述当发生阴影时要进行的处理的图。
[0039]图21是表示图17的S625中的移动识别处理的过程的流程图。
[0040]图22A、图22B、图22C以及图22D是用于描述根据原稿对残留图像区域的进入、残留图像逐渐消失的状态的图。
[0041]图23是表示图17的S625中的移动识别处理的过程的流程图。
[0042]图24A、图24B、图24C、图24D、图24E、图24F、图24G以及图24H是用于描述通过原稿对残留图像区域的进入、残留图像逐渐被切除的状态的图。
[0043]图25是表示图17的S625中的移动识别处理的过程的流程图。
[0044]图26A、图26B以及图26C是用于描述原稿操作以及显示图像的示例的图。
[0045]图27是例示当生成要存储在图3的RAM中的缩略图像时生成的文档属性信息以及图像属性信息的图。
[0046]图28A、图28B、图28C、图28D、图28E以及图28F是例示缩略图像的坐标以及显示图像的图。
[0047]图29是表示图11的S623中的残留图像处理的过程的流程图。
[0048]图30A、图30B以及图30C是用于描述原稿操作以及显示图像的示例的图。
[0049]图31是表示图17的S625中的移动识别处理的过程的流程图。
[0050]图32A是例示了在读取区域205中显示缩略图像的预定区域的图,图32B是例示了原稿与该区域中显示的缩略图像交叠的情形的图,图32C是例示了要布置缩略图像的位置被改变的情形的图。
[0051]图33A、图33B以及图33C是例示原稿与被缩略图像填满的预定区域交叠的情形的图。
[0052]图34A、图34B、图34C以及图34D是例示缩略图像被重新布置的情形的图。
[0053]图35A、图35B以及图35C是例示缩略图像被归结显示的情形的图。
[0054]图36A、图36B、图36C以及图36D是例示缩略图像被缩小并显示的情形的图。
[0055]图37A、图37B、图37C、图37D以及图37E是例示在缩小处理中缩略图像的大小被缩小过多的情形的图。
[0056]图38是表示图17的S625中的移动识别处理的过程的流程图。
[0057]图39是表示图17的S625中的移动识别处理的过程的流程图。
[0058]图40是表示图38的S2807中的缩略图像偏移处理的过程的流程图。
[0059]图41是表示要通过摄像处理部和定时检测部进行的残留图像投影处理的过程的流程图。
[0060]图42是表示图41的S625中的移动识别处理的过程的流程图。
[0061]图43是表示图41的S627中的缩略图像处理的过程的流程图。
[0062]图44A、图44B、图44C、图44D、图44E、图44F以及图44G是例示搜索缩略图像可以被布置的区域的情形的图。
[0063]图45是表示图42的S2807中的缩略图像偏移处理的过程的流程图。
【具体实施方式】
[0064]以下将根据附图来详细描述本发明的优选实施例。
[0065][第一实施例]
[0066]图1是例示根据本发明的实施例的包括照相机扫描器101的扫描器系统100的示意图。
[0067]在图1中,通过网络104连接到主计算机102和打印机103的照相机扫描器101可以响应于来自主计算机102的指令,进行用于从照相机扫描器101读取图像的扫描功能以及用于向打印机103输出扫描数据的打印功能。
[0068]另外,无需使用主计算机102而能够直接指示照相机扫描器101进行扫描功能和打印功能。
[0069]图2是例示图1的照相机扫描器101的外观的图。
[0070]在图2中,照相机扫描器101大体由控制器单元201、照相机202、臂单元203以及投影仪207构成。
[0071]图2示出了照相机扫描器101被放置在原稿板204上的情形。这里,用作摄像设备的照相机202的镜头朝向原稿板204,由此可以对读取区域205中的图像进行读取和拍摄,该读取区域205被虚线围绕并用作可以摆放原稿的摄像区域。在图2所示的示例中,原稿206被摆放在读取区域205中。
[0072]用作照相机扫描器101的主体的控制器单元201和照相机202通过臂单元203彼此连接。臂单元203通过利用关节(joint)而可以自由弯曲和拉伸。用作显示设备的投影仪207向原稿板204等投影用于协助操作的图像来显示图像。另外,可以替代投影仪207而使用LCD (液晶显示器)触摸屏。
[0073]图3是例示图2的控制器单元201的示意性框图。
[0074]在图3中,控制器单元201主要由分别连接到系统总线301的CPU(中央处理单元)302、存储设备、各种控制器以及各种接口构成。
[0075]CPU 302对控制器单元201的整体操作进行控制。RAM 303是易失性存储器,ROM(只读存储器)304是非易失性存储器。针对CPU 302的引导程序(代码)等被存储在ROM 304 中。
[0076]HDD (硬盘驱动器)305与RAM 303相比具有大存储容量。要由控制器单元201执行的用于照相机扫描器101的控制以及其他各种程序被存储在HDD 305中。
[0077]CPU 302在通过通电等启动控制器单元时执行存储在ROM 304中的引导程序代码。这里,引导程序代码是要用于读取存储在HDD 305中的控制程序代码并将所读取的代码提取到RAM 303中的代码。
[0078]如果引导程序代码被执行,则CPU 302通过执行提取到RAM 303中的控制程序代码来进行各种控制。顺便提及,在CPU 302执行被存储在HDD 305中然后被提取到RAM 303中的程序代码的条件下,进行稍后描述的流程图的处理。
[0079]另外,CPU 302将要用于通过控制程序的操作的数据存储在RAM 303中,并且从RAM 303中读取该数据。另外,诸如通过控制程序的操作所必须的各种设置、由照相机输入而生成的图像数据等的各种数据可以被存储在HDD 305中,并且所存储的各种数据被CPU302读取和写入。
[0080]CPU 302通过网络I/F (接口)306进行与网络104上的其他设备的通信。
[0081]图像处理器307读取存储在RAM 303中的图像数据,处理所读取的数据,将处理后的数据写回到RAM 303中。这里,要由图像处理器307进行的图像处理包括旋转处理、倍率改变处理、色彩转换处理等。
[0082]连接到照相机202的照相机I/F 308响应于来自CPU 302的指令,从照相机202获得图像数据并且将获得的数据写入到RAM 303中。另外,照相机I/F将来自CPU 302的控制命令发送到照相机202以设置和控制照相机202。
[0083]投影仪207和IXD触摸屏330连接至的显示控制器309响应于来自CPU 302的指令,使投影仪和LCD触摸屏中的各个显示图像。
[0084]输入和输出串行信号的串行I/F 310连接到IXD触摸屏330。这样,当IXD触摸屏330被按下时,CPU 302通过串行I/F 310获得对应于所按下位置的坐标。
[0085]连接到扬声器340的音频控制器311响应于CPU 302的指令,将音频数据转换成模拟音频信号并且进一步通过扬声器340输出声音。
[0086]USB (通用串行总线)控制器312响应于CPU 302的指令来控制外部USB设备。这里,诸如USB存储器、SD (安全数字)卡等的外部存储器350连接到USB控制器312,从而从外部存储器读取数据以及向外部存储器写入数据。
[0087]图4是例示用于控制图1的照相机扫描器101的控制程序401的框图。
[0088]在图4中,如上所述,在启动照相机扫描器的操作时,CPU 302将已被存储在HDD305中的照相机扫描器101的控制程序提取到RAM 303中并且执行该控制程序。
[0089]用于照相机扫描器101的控制程序401包括主控制部402、操作显示部403、网络通信部404、数据管理部405、摄像处理部406、图像识别部407、显示处理部408以及输出文件生成部409。
[0090]作为程序主体的主控制部402通过控制程序中的各个模块来执行照相机扫描器控制程序。操作显示部403响应于来自主控制部402的描绘请求,通过显示控制器309进行对投影仪207或LCD触摸屏330的描绘操作。
[0091]另外,在IXD触摸屏330被按下时,操作显示部403通过串行I/F 310接收与按下位置对应的坐标,将描绘操作中的操作画面的内容与接收的坐标相关联,决定所按下按钮的操作内容等,然后将决定的操作内容通知给主控制部402。上述的操作显示部403使显示设备将基于从原稿提取的原稿图像数据生成的并且对应于表示原稿的图像的残留图像显示在原稿被摆放的位置。另外,如稍后所描述的,如果检测到原稿进入检测区域,则操作显示部403使显示设备将残留图像的缩略图像显示为,使得该缩略图像不与进入检测区域的原稿交叠。
[0092]网络通信部404经由网络I/F 306,通过TCP/IP (发送控制协议/互联网协议)进行与网络104上的其他设备的通信。
[0093]数据管理部405将执行控制程序401所需的设置数据等存储在HDD305的预定区域中,并管理存储的数据。
[0094]摄像处理部406通过照相机I/F 308控制照相机202,并且将在通过定时检测部410检测到的定时拍摄的照相机图像发送到图像识别部407。
[0095]由移动识别部412生成并且对应于照相机图像的命令被发送到显示处理部408。
[0096]定时检测部410检测原稿的入镜定时、搁置定时以及出镜定时。可以基于从照相机202接收的照相机图像来检测上述定时。
[0097]这里,出镜定时可以被设置为就在原稿从读取区域205出镜之前的定时,当原稿开始出镜时的定时,或者上述两个定时之间的任意定时。
[0098]移动识别部412通过针对从照相机202接收的各帧计算照相机图像的帧间差,来识别手或原稿在原稿台上的移动,并且将检测到的移动转换成预先关联的命令。
[0099]这样,能够通过在原稿台上朝着照相机进行诸如挥手操作等的手势操作来对照相机扫描器101给出指令。上述的摄像处理部406检测到原稿进入用于检测原稿的检测区域。
[0100]图像识别部407从照相机202接收照相机图像,并且识别接收的照相机图像的内容。
[0101]图像识别部407中包括的原稿图像数据提取部411从在通过定时检测部410检测到的搁置定时拍摄的并且从照相机发送的照相机图像中,提取原稿图像数据。提取的原
当前第1页1 2 3 4 5 6 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1